Australia Energy Storage Market: Renewable Integration, Grid Resilience & Technology Advancements

How increasing integration of renewable energy, focus on grid resilience and rapid advancements in storage technologies are shaping Australia’s energy storage market

By Shrestha RoyPublished about 6 hours ago 3 min read

According to IMARC Group, the Australia energy storage market reached 4.72 GW in 2025 and is projected to expand significantly to 19.81 GW by 2034, exhibiting a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 17.28% during 2026–2034. This rapid expansion highlights the critical role energy storage plays in transforming the electricity ecosystem across Australia. As renewable energy capacity accelerates and coal-fired plants retire, storage systems are becoming essential for maintaining grid stability, ensuring reliability and supporting long-term decarbonization goals. From large-scale battery installations to residential storage units, energy storage is emerging as a cornerstone of Australia’s clean energy transition.

What Are the Key Growth Drivers in the Australia Energy Storage Market?

Rising Renewable Energy Integration

Australia’s rapid expansion of solar and wind generation has created new grid management challenges. Renewable energy sources are inherently intermittent, requiring flexible systems to balance supply and demand. Battery energy storage systems (BESS) absorb excess generation during peak production periods and release power when demand rises or renewable output falls.

Focus on Grid Resilience

Extreme weather events and aging infrastructure have underscored the importance of grid resilience. Storage systems provide backup power during outages and enhance grid reliability in remote and regional areas. Large-scale battery projects are increasingly replacing traditional gas peaker plants for frequency control and load balancing.

Retirement of Coal-Fired Plants

The gradual phase-out of coal generation capacity is accelerating investment in storage solutions. Storage technologies enable renewable power to replace baseload generation more effectively, smoothing the transition to a cleaner energy mix.

Technological Advancements

Improvements in lithium-ion battery efficiency, lifecycle performance and cost reduction are enhancing commercial viability. Emerging technologies such as flow batteries, solid-state storage and hydrogen-based systems are diversifying the storage landscape.

Expansion of Distributed Energy Resources (DER)

Household solar-plus-storage systems are gaining traction. Residential and commercial customers are installing batteries to reduce electricity bills, increase self-consumption and protect against outages. Virtual power plants (VPPs) aggregate distributed storage assets to provide grid services.

Government Support and Policy Incentives

Federal and state initiatives promote renewable integration and storage deployment through grants, subsidies and infrastructure programs. Policy clarity surrounding emissions reduction strengthens investor confidence.

Growing Corporate Sustainability Goals

Businesses are investing in on-site storage to ensure energy security and meet sustainability commitments. Long-term renewable power purchase agreements often integrate battery systems for demand optimization.
